Summary
On July 11, 2025, a Piper PA-18-150 (N8979D) was involved in an incident near Palmer, AK. All 1 person aboard were uninjured. The aircraft sustained substantial damage.
The National Transportation Safety Board determined the probable cause of this incident to be: The pilot's excessive braking during the landing roll, resulting in a nose over.
